Definition of muster - Reverso English Dictionary

Verb

tr.
1.
organizationcollect or assemble a group for a purpose
  • She mustered a team for the project.
assemble collect gather
2.
summon couragegather up personal strength or courage
  • She mustered the courage to speak out..
gather mobilize summon
3.
militaryTECH.gather people for military inspectionTECH.
  • The troops mustered at dawn for inspection.
assemble mobilize
4.
agricultureRareUKround up livestockRareUK
  • They mustered the cattle for branding.
assemble gather

Noun

1.
assemblyact of assembling a group of people
  • The team's muster was scheduled before the project kickoff..
assembly gathering
2.
militaryTECH.gathering of military personnel for inspectionTECH.
  • The soldiers attended the morning muster.
assembly gathering roll call
3.
animalsTECH.group of peafowlTECH.
  • A muster of peafowl wandered through the garden.
congregation flock

Origin of muster

Old French, moustrer (to show)
